Gardendale, San Antonio,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Gardendale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gardendale Studio Apartments | $1,141 | $625 | $1,621 |
| Gardendale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,280 | $599 | $4,325 |
| Gardendale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,695 | $529 | $3,207 |
| Gardendale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,479 | $1,250 | $5,093 |
| Gardendale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,200 | $1,200 | $1,200 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Gardendale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$1,449 | $850 | $2,750 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$1,742 | $1,100 | $3,495 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$1,700 | $1,600 | $1,900 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$4,775 | $4,775 | $4,775 |
